Five Lafayette Field Hockey Players Receive All-Patriot League Honors with Stella Malinowski Named Rookie of the Year

Key points:

  • Five Lafayette field hockey players earn All-Patriot League honors
  • Stella Malinowski named Rookie of the Year
  • Lafayette prepares to face Boston in the Patriot League Tournament semifinals

Five student-athletes from Lafayette field hockey have earned All-Patriot League honors, making them the conference’s highest number of honorees. Stella Malinowski, a rookie midfielder, was named Rookie of the Year and also received Second-Team recognition. Junior co-captain Lineke Spaans and sophomore Makenzie Switzer earned spots on the First-Team squad, while junior Laine Delmotte and sophomore Josephine van Wijk were named to the Second-Team. The Leopards finished the regular season with an 11-6 record and will face Boston University in the Patriot League Tournament semifinal round.
